More contract talks going on, says Potter

22nd November
First team

Graham Potter says contract talks are continuing at Swansea City despite a rash of new deals being agreed.

Connor Roberts has today put pen to paper on a fresh agreement which ties him to the Swans until the summer of 2022.

The Wales right-back follows in the footsteps of Joe Rodon, Jay Fulton and Matt Grimes, who have also signed new Liberty contracts this month.

But Potter has indicated that further deals are in the pipeline as the Swans look to secure the futures of various members of their squad.

“There are more talks going on,” he said at his pre-match press conference ahead of Saturday’s clash with Norwich.

“There are a few players whose contracts are up next summer and that process is going on.

“These things go on between the club and the players and you respect the fact that they take time.

“Then, when we have got something to announce, we will announce it.”
